Patent number: 8745014Abstract: A method for storing time series data in a key-value database includes receiving time series data relating to the occurrence of an event. An addressing scheme that defines attributes for inclusion in keys for the event is analyzed. The attributes include time granularity attributes of different sizes. The method generates a key corresponding to the time series data based on the analyzing of the addressing scheme including attributes specified in the addressing scheme that are related to the event and one of the attributes represents one of the plurality of time granularity attributes. The method further issues a command to the key-value database to store a record of the occurrence of the event as a value in the key-value database where stored values in the key-value database corresponding keys may be used to satisfy queries relating to the event over a range of time.Type: GrantFiled: October 19, 2011Date of Patent: June 3, 2014Assignee: Pivotal Software, Inc.Inventor: Jonathan Travis

Patent number: 8645404Abstract: A split data word including a portion of each of two word-aligned data words stored at two word-aligned address boundaries within a memory is read from a displaced-read memory address relative to the word-aligned address boundaries within the memory. The portions of each of the two word-aligned data words within the split data word are compared with corresponding portions of a word-aligned search pattern. A determination is made that a potential complete match for the word-aligned search pattern exists within at least one of the two word-aligned data words based upon an identified match of at least one of the portions of the two word-aligned data words within the split data word with a corresponding at least one portion of the word-aligned search pattern.Type: GrantFiled: October 21, 2011Date of Patent: February 4, 2014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ventors: K. Patent number: 8620590Abstract: Methods, systems, and apparatus for accurately determining a proportion (ratio) of two analytes is provided, as well as provide a concentration of a first analyte from a determined concentration of a second analyte and from a proportion of the analytes to each other. In one aspect, a surface model (called a “dose surface” herein) relating the concentrations of the two analytes to the proportion can be used to obtain accurate values for one of the variables (e.g. a concentration or the proportion) when the other two variables have previously been obtained. The dose surface can be a three-dimensional surface and be non-linear. The dose surface model can include multiple regression functions. For example, measured responses can be individually converted to concentrations using two dose-response curves, and the concentrations can be input to a dose surface function to obtain the proportion.Type: GrantFiled: September 30, 2010Date of Patent: December 31, 2013Assignee: Bio-Rad Laboratories, Inc.Inventors: Yabin Lu, Roger Walker

Publication number: 20130325825Abstract: In accordance with the teachings described herein, systems and methods are provided for estimating quantiles for data stored in a distributed system. In one embodiment, an instruction is received to estimate a specified quantile for a variate in a set of data stored at a plurality of nodes in the distributed system. A plurality of data bins for the variate are defined that are each associated with a different range of data values in the set of data. Lower and upper quantile bounds for each of the plurality of data bins are determined based on the total number of data values that fall within each of the plurality of data bins. The specified quantile is estimated based on an identified one of the plurality of data bins that includes the specified quantile based on the lower and upper quantile bounds.Type: ApplicationFiled: May 29, 2012Publication date: December 5, 2013Inventors: Scott Pope, Georges H. Patent number: 8543557Abstract: An optical metrology includes a library, a metrology tool and a library evolution tool. The library is generated to include a series of predicted measurements. Each predicted measurement is intended to match the measurements that a metrology device would record when analyzing a corresponding physical structure. The metrology tool compares its empirical measurements to the predicted measurements in the library. If a match is found, the metrology tool extracts a description of the corresponding physical structure from the library. The library evolution tool operates to improve the efficiency of the library. To make these improvements, the library evolution tool statistically analyzes the usage pattern of the library. Based on this analysis, the library evolution tool increases the resolution of commonly used portions of the library. The library evolution tool may also optionally reduce the resolution of less used portions of the library.Type: GrantFiled: April 1, 2005Date of Patent: September 24, 2013Assignee: KLA-Tencor CorporationInventors: David M. Patent number: 8532931Abstract: A method for calculating a sample size for a clinical trial of a first treatment can be provided. The method can include reading a survival curve from a clinical trial for a second treatment, wherein the clinical trial may be selected by a user interacting with a user interface. The method can further include selecting a plurality of points on the survival curve and storing coordinates for each of the plurality of points, wherein the plurality of points are selected so as to capture substantial features of the survival curve. Then, a hazard curve is generated based on the coordinates that were stored, wherein the hazard curve may be a step function. The method can further include calculating a sample size for the clinical trial of the first treatment using a Markov model based on the hazard curve.Type: GrantFiled: September 7, 2008Date of Patent: September 10, 2013Inventor: Edward Lakatos

Patent number: 8478538Abstract: According to embodiments, techniques for extracting a signal parameter from a selected region of a generally repetitive signal are disclosed. A pulse oximetry system including a sensor or probe may be used to obtain an original photoplethysmograph (PPG) signal from a subject. A filter transformation may be applied to the original PPG signal to produce a baseline PPG signal. The baseline PPG signal may contain artifacts and/or noise, and a region of the baseline PPG signal suitable for extracting the signal parameter may be selected. A suitable region of the baseline PPG signal may be selected by applying one or more thresholds to the baseline PPG signal, where the values of the thresholds may be set based on derivative values, amplitude-based percentiles, and/or local minima and maxima of the baseline PPG signal. A portion of the original PPG signal corresponding to the selected region may be processed, and the signal parameter may be extracted from the processed region.Type: GrantFiled: May 7, 2009Date of Patent: July 2, 2013Assignee: Nellcor Puritan Bennett IrelandInventors: Scott McGonigle, Paul S.
